Asian Flu Pandemic
The Asian Flu Pandemic of 1957-1958 swept across Asia and beyond, causing global health crises and reshaping public health responses in the 20th century.
Asian Flu Pandemic refers to the global outbreak of influenza caused by the H2N2 subtype of the influenza A virus, first identified in 1957. Originating in East Asia, it rapidly spread worldwide, causing widespread illness and significant mortality. This pandemic marks one of the major influenza outbreaks of the 20th century following the 1918 influenza pandemic and is notable for its rapid transmission facilitated by modern transportation, the development of a targeted vaccine, and its distinctive epidemiological patterns affecting various age groups and regions.
Asian Flu Emergence and Virological Characteristics
The Asian Flu pandemic began in early 1957, with the first cases traced back to southern China. The causative agent was identified as the H2N2 influenza A virus, a novel strain resulting from a genetic reassortment between avian viruses and previously circulating human influenza strains. This new virus possessed distinct surface proteins hemagglutinin (H2) and neuraminidase (N2), which contributed to its ability to evade preexisting immunity in the human population.
The virus quickly moved from southern China to Hong Kong, where a significant outbreak was recorded by mid-1957. The rapid spread to other parts of Asia was facilitated by dense population centers and frequent regional travel.
Global Spread and Transmission Routes
Asian Regional Spread
Following the initial outbreak in southern China and Hong Kong, the Asian Flu spread throughout the continent, affecting countries in East, Southeast, and South Asia. Dense urban centers and limited immunity in the population allowed for swift transmission.
Air Travel Spread
The pandemic marked one of the first instances where commercial air travel significantly accelerated the global spread of an infectious disease. Infected individuals traveling by plane carried the virus from Asia to Europe, North America, and other continents within weeks.
Shipping Routes
Maritime trade routes also facilitated the dissemination of the virus, particularly impacting port cities where large numbers of travelers and goods converged.
Spread to Europe, North America, Latin America, Africa, and the Middle East
The virus arrived in Europe and North America by mid to late 1957, with major outbreaks recorded in the fall and winter months. Latin America, Africa, and the Middle East experienced subsequent waves, reflecting the interconnectedness of global populations.
Epidemiological Patterns
Infection Among School-Age Children
The Asian Flu disproportionately affected school-age children and young adults, likely due to a lack of prior exposure and immunity. Schools became focal points of transmission, leading to widespread absenteeism and disruption.
Mortality Patterns
While the mortality rate was lower compared to the 1918 influenza pandemic, the Asian Flu caused an estimated 1 to 2 million deaths worldwide. Mortality was notably higher among the elderly and individuals with preexisting health conditions, but the virus also caused severe illness in younger populations.
Vaccine Development and Public Health Measures
Vaccine Development
In response to the rapid spread, scientists quickly isolated the H2N2 virus and developed an effective vaccine by the summer of 1957. The vaccine production and distribution represented a significant public health achievement, although demand outstripped supply in many regions during the initial phase.
Mass Vaccination Campaigns
Many countries initiated mass immunization programs targeting high-risk populations, including healthcare workers, the elderly, and schoolchildren. These campaigns helped to mitigate the severity and duration of the pandemic waves.
Public Health Measures
In addition to vaccination, public health authorities implemented quarantine measures, school closures, public gathering restrictions, and hygiene promotion to reduce transmission. These interventions varied in intensity and success depending on the region.
Pandemic Timeline and Historical Assessment
The Asian Flu pandemic unfolded rapidly from early 1957, peaking globally by the end of that year and continuing with subsequent waves into 1958 and 1959. The pandemic served as a critical case study in the impact of global travel on infectious disease spread and the importance of rapid vaccine development.
Historically, the Asian Flu pandemic underscored the need for international cooperation in disease surveillance and response. It also highlighted the potential for influenza viruses to undergo genetic shifts, reinforcing the importance of ongoing monitoring and preparedness for future pandemics.

Mathematical Representation of Basic Reproduction Number (R₀)
The basic reproduction number, R₀, represents the average number of secondary infections produced by a single infected individual in a fully susceptible population. For the Asian Flu, estimates ranged between 1.5 and 2.0, indicating moderate transmissibility.
